The Role of Carbon Sinks in Climate Change Mitigation

Carbon sinks, both natural and artificial, play a crucial role in absorbing atmospheric carbon dioxide. Natural sinks like oceans and forests use biological processes to capture CO2, with oceans absorbing about 50% of emissions. However, these sinks have limitations, such as ocean acidification. Artificial techniques aim to enhance carbon sequestration but face efficiency challenges. While carbon sinks help combat climate change, reducing fossil fuel dependence and increasing renewable energy use are essential for long-term solutions.
